Isaac Rosso Klakovich works within the public affairs practice, where he supports clients in developing and executing integrated campaigns to reach key stakeholders, grow and enhance their reputation and achieve policy, regulatory, and reputational goals. As a Consultant in APCO’s Washington office, he advises clients on domestic and global policy issues across a range of sectors, including energy, transportation, education and sports.
Outside of APCO, Isaac has experience contributing to and managing political campaigns at various levels of government. Most recently, he supported Kamala Harris’s presidential campaign and Josh Stein’s campaign for North Carolina attorney general.
Isaac graduated from the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ill with a Bachelor of Arts in public relations and political science.
